The reserve is situated on the south-western shore of the former Whittlesey Mere. The mere was drained in 1851 after years of falling water levels, and within a short time reedbed had been replaced by fields of wheat.

Peterborough Panthers are a professional Speedway team racing in the SGB Premiership, the top tier of British Speedway. Home meetings take place at the East of England Showground, usually on a Monday or Thursday night.
